Weather and moisture damage in outdoor structures is a common concern for homeowners who want to maintain the integrity and appearance of their property. When people search for this topic, they are often looking for information about how rain, snow, humidity, and other weather conditions can cause deterioration over time. This damage can manifest in various ways, including rotting wood, rusted metal, cracked paint, and weakened foundations. Understanding how moisture infiltrates outdoor structures helps homeowners identify the signs of damage early and plan for repairs before issues worsen.
This topic is closely related to projects involving outdoor decks, fences, siding, pergolas, gazebos, and other exposed structures. Many property owners notice warping, discoloration, or soft spots in wooden parts, or rust and corrosion in metal components. These problems are often linked to inadequate drainage, poor sealing, or aging materials that have been compromised by persistent exposure to moisture. What causes weather and moisture damage in outdoor structures? Weather and moisture damage typically result from prolonged exposure to rain, snow, humidity, and temperature fluctuations, which can weaken materials like wood, siding, and decking.
How can local contractors repair weather and moisture damage in outdoor structures? Local contractors assess the extent of damage, replace or reinforce compromised materials, and apply protective treatments to prevent future issues.
What signs indicate weather and moisture damage in outdoor structures? Common signs include rotting wood, peeling paint, mold or mildew growth, warping, and visible water stains or discoloration.
Are there preventive measures to reduce weather and moisture damage? Yes, applying sealants, maintaining proper drainage, and performing regular inspections can help minimize moisture-related issues in outdoor structures.
What types of outdoor structures are most vulnerable to weather and moisture damage? Structures like decks, fences, siding, pergolas, and outdoor furniture are especially susceptible to moisture and weather-related deterioration.
